I enjoy both older and new movies/tv shows. One thing I love about a lot of the old war movies is just how awesome the spectacle is. One in particular that really blew my mind when I first saw it was The Longest Day (has a huge and generally all star cast as well). It's amazing that a movie from 1962 could have such huge battle scenes. One in particular is when they are doing the first landings on the beaches. It's really impressive when you think about them making that in 1962. Every person you see running on the beach is real, no CGI cheating/doubling, nothing like that, everything is REAL props, REAL people. Now don't get me wrong, I don't hate CGI (well some I do, but generally if it's done well and not overused its fine), it's just awesome. Another movie that goes along the same idea is the 1970 Waterloo. Now note, the film has a TON (and I mean a TON) of inaccurate things in it and is NOT a good realistic/accurate depiction of the battle of Waterloo, however, for the shear scale of it, it's very awe inspiring and impressive. It's a movie I would recommend just so you could get a sense of scale of how huge the armies were back then. Mass cavalry and all that, very impressive.
